28 Days Skin Cycle For Beautiful Skin
Almost for every woman skin goes through a 28 days cycles. On certain days, your skin glows from within and for few days it becomes very dry, dull and extra sensitive.

Our first phase starts on 1st day of your period. It will last from Day 1 to day 7.
During this phase, estrogen level starts to decline, that’s why you feel your skin extra dry, dull and dehydrated.
This time, make sure you keep yourself well hydrated and use a good moisturiser on your skin, so it feels soft and supple.
You should always use a good vitamin C and niacinamide serum on your face. after cleansing, also make sure that serum contains hyaluronic acid, as it helps skin to hold water
Now coming to phase 2, Day 8 to Day 14
After 7 days of estrogen declining, it means when your period end, estrogen starts to increase slowly, and new skin cells starts to appear.
This hormone stimulates the production of collagen, elastin and hyaluronic acid, thereby impacting your skin’s structural integrity and moisture retention. When estrogen is at its peak, your skin looks and feels plump, hydrated and wrinkle-free.
This is the best time to exfoliate your skin, so new skin cells can appear on top and can breathe well
It is always better to exfoliate your skin with A-H-A peels, you can also use milk or yogurt as natural lactic acid peel on your face
Now coming to phase 3, Day 15 to Day 21
In this phase, your progesterone level will start to increase, that can increase the sebum production. It can also stimulate skin’s oil glands, making them produce more oil.
When oil clog your pores, it can lead to breakouts and dark spots on your face.
Make sure you clean your face very well before going to bed, and do spot treatment for your acne and dark spots.
You can also choose a good retinoid cream to keep acne and spots away from your face
Now coming to last phase of your skin cycle , that lasts from Day 22 to Day 28
During last phase, your testosterone level increases, that’s why many people get breakout just before periods
This is the time when you should start to use anti-bacterial face wash twice in a day to prevent breakouts on your face
You can also use either tea tree or apple cider vinegar face toner on face after cleansing, as they are effective to prevent acne
